In this picture, I adjusted the aperature so as to create a shallow depth of field. This blurs the background, while leaving the tree trunk and its mossy bark in clear focus.

For this picture I adjusted the white balance on my camera because it was extremely sunny. The lighting was hard light as it was taken early afternoon and you can see her shadow. Post processing: in Lightroom, I increased the clarity and vibrance and increased the exposure just a little bit. I also added some vignetting to darken the edges a little bit. I think that the lighting, vibrance, and how she is dressed really helped to reveal character. Her facial expression made her seem somewhat serious and almost mysterious. Even though the picture was taken from farther away, her eyes are still in focus and she is maintaining eye contact with the camera. I chose to add this picture to my portfolio because I love how vibrant it is and it was a really fun picture to take.
